Police shoot and kill Baton Rouge man Alton Sterling
Alton Sterling, a black, 37-year-old resident of Baton Rouge, Louisiana, died Tuesday during an encounter with local police officers outside a Triple S Food Mart in East Baton Rouge Parish. Sterling was killed after officers tackled him to the ground, pinned him and shot him multiple times. Officers later withdrew a gun from Sterlingâs pocket. Graphic video captured the violent incident.
Update:Â Louisiana congressman Cedric Richmond, who covers the second district in Louisiana, called on the Department of Justice to investigate the death of 37-year-old area man Alton Sterling.Â
âThe video footage released today ⌠was deeply troubling and has understandably evoked strong emotion and anger in our community,â Rep. Richmond said in a statement. âThere are a number of unanswered questions surrounding Mr. Sterlingâs death.â
Update:Â The U.S. Department of Justice will lead a civil rights probe into the shooting of Alton Sterling, Louisiana Gov. John Bel Edwards said during a press conference Wednesday.Â
While Edwards was not able to release the identities of the officers involved in the shooting, Baton Rouge, Louisiana, officials announced their names via press release.
Update: More information has come to light about the officers involved, Blane Salamoni and Howie Lake. It is unclear which of the two officers fired the shots, but both told East Baton Rouge District Attorney Hillar Moore that they felt âcompletely justified in using deadly force.â Hereâs everything we know about Salamoni  and Lake.
